Rwanda Ready for Fiba 3×3 World Cup Qualifier 2023, Mutokambali
Rwanda men’s 3×3 head coach, Moïse Mutokambali, has said his players are in good shape and ready to put up impressive performance during the forthcoming FIBA 3×3 World Cup Qualifier 2023 slated for May 6-7 in Israel.
The team has for the past week been training from Lycee de Kigali gymnasium and Mutokambali was impressed with how the players were responding to the sessions with a promising level of performance that he hopes can be of great impact during their quest for a ticket to the 3×3 World Cup 2023.
“I am happy with the players I have, they are giving their 100 percent in training and I was impressed by their commitment on and off the field,” he said
Rwanda was placed in Group B alongside Asian giants China and Caribbean nation Trinidad and Tobago.
In December 2022, Rwanda impressed at the FIBA 3×3 Africa Cup 2022 held in Cairo, Egypt, after grabbing a third place finish following a 21-17 victory over Tunisia to win bronze.
It was the first medal the country has ever won in the FIBA 3×3 Africa Cup.
Twelve teams – six in each of men and women categories- will compete for the last three tickets to the FIBA 3×3 World Cup 2023 finals which will take place in Vienna, Austria, from May 30 to June 6.
